The Star-News - Serving the communities of Chula Vista and National City When the National City News, which first published in 1882 and the Chula Vista Star—founded in 1918— merged in 1954 they formed The Star-News The Star-News serves a combined population of 350,000-plus residents in the cities of Chula Vista and National City in San Diego County The Star-News newspaper is published every Friday A subsidiary of CommunityMedia Corp , The Star-News delivers

Stars - NASA Science Astronomers estimate that the universe could contain up to one septillion stars – that’s a one followed by 24 zeros Our Milky Way alone contains more than 100 billion, including our most well-studied star, the Sun Stars are giant balls of hot gas – mostly hydrogen, with some helium and small amounts of other elements Every star has its own life cycle, ranging from a few million to
